Al is probably the hardest entertainer to authenticate because he does such a quick lackluster signature. I think he is someone you need to get in person and have a photo of him signing to verify. Honestly, impossible to authenticate.

I agree with Nick.

Or perhaps try locating an earlier example of his signature.  I realize vintage is more scarce (and probably more expensive) but it is legible:
